Plastic Pelletizing Unit: Improving Reclamation Productivity
Innovative resin granulating machines are changing the reclamation industry by considerably enhancing productivity. These units process waste plastic materials into uniform pellets, a form readily usable for remanufacturing. Compared to traditional processes, pelletizing machines minimize consumption and loss, leading in a more sustainable method to plastic waste.

Plastic Film Washing Line: Process and Technology Overview
The synthetic membrane washing system employs a series of modern processes to eliminate contaminants from discarded or rejected plastic. Typically, the initial step involves bulk debris removal via physical screening equipment. Following this, the film passes through a several rinsing method , often utilizing high-pressure fluid jets and detergent mixtures. Advanced processes like ultrasonic agitation or thermal breakdown may be applied to enhance cleaning efficacy . Finally, the cleaned plastic is desiccated and readied for further processing or reuse. The complete line aims to produce a pristine plastic input for later applications.
